Potter, Tony J.
Army Private 1st class

Tony J. Potter, age 20, from Okmulgee, Oklahoma, Okmulgee county.

Service era: Afghanistan
Military history: 1st Battalion, 279th Infantry Regiment, 45th Infantry Brigade Combat Team, Oklahoma National Guard, Tulsa, Oklahoma.

Date of death: Friday, September 9, 2011
Death details: Died of wounds suffered when enemy forces attacked his unit with small arms fire in Paktia, Afghanistan. Killed were Sgt. Bret D. Isenhower, Spc. Christopher D. Horton, Pfc. Tony J. Potter Jr.

Source: Department of Defense

Randolph, Tony Michael
Navy Petty officer 2nd class

Tony Michael Randolph, age 22, from Henryetta, Oklahome, Okmulgee county. Their last known residence was in Henryetta.

Service era: Afghanistan
Military history: Assigned to Combined Security Transition Command, Afghanistan.

Date of death: Monday, July 6, 2009
Death details: Died in an improvised explosive device attack on his convoy in northern Afghanistan.

Source: Department of Defense, Military Times

Reed, Ray Ellison
Marines Reserves Private

Ray Ellison Reed from Okmulgee County Okmulgee, Oklahoma .

Parents: J. E. Reed

Service era: World War II

Date of death: Sunday, December 7, 1941
Death details: Killed aboard the USS Arizona. Remains not recovered.

Source: National Archives, Honolulu Star Advertiser (2016), Tulsa Tribune (1942)

Williams, Clyde Richard
Navy Musician 2nd class

Clyde Richard Williams, age 19, from Okmulgee County Okmulgee, Oklahoma .

Service era: World War II

Date of death: Sunday, December 7, 1941
Death details: Killed aboard the USS Arizona. Remains not recovered.

Source: National Archives, Okmulgee Daily Times (2015)
